The medical student has found several fossils that date back to the Jurassic period on the beaches of Whitby in Yorkshire. Perhaps the most spectacular is a 185-million-year-old fossil encased by what looks like a 'golden canon' ball. Mr. Smith, 23, is a seasoned fossil collector and continues to go and explore the seaside in hope of finding similar treasures. "The limestone nodule is coated in Iron Pyrite, meaning we can polish it to become Golden, seen in our previous videos. "It still impresses me that these 185 million-year-old fossils are along our beautiful Yorkshire Coastline waiting to be found."
